当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储的概念,深入剖析,对象存储与对象存储集群的区别及层级解析

对象存储的概念,深入剖析,对象存储与对象存储集群的区别及层级解析

对象存储是一种存储数据的方式,以对象为单位进行管理。本文深入剖析了对象存储的概念,并解析了对象存储与对象存储集群的区别,包括它们在层级上的差异。...

对象存储是一种存储数据的方式,以对象为单位进行管理。本文深入剖析了对象存储的概念,并解析了对象存储与对象存储集群的区别,包括它们在层级上的差异。

随着互联网技术的飞速发展,数据存储需求日益增长,对象存储作为一种新型存储技术,因其灵活、高效、易扩展等特点,被广泛应用于各大行业,在实际应用中,对象存储与对象存储集群之间存在诸多区别,本文将从概念、架构、性能、适用场景等多个维度对两者进行深入剖析,以帮助读者更好地理解两者之间的层级关系。

对象存储的概念

1、定义

对象存储(Object Storage)是一种基于文件系统的分布式存储技术,它将数据存储为对象,每个对象包含数据本体、元数据和唯一标识符,对象存储系统通常采用RESTful API进行访问,支持大规模、高并发的数据存储和访问。

2、特点

(1)数据粒度小:对象存储将数据细分为一个个小对象,便于管理和扩展。

对象存储的概念,深入剖析,对象存储与对象存储集群的区别及层级解析

(2)高并发:对象存储系统支持高并发访问,适用于大规模数据存储场景。

(3)分布式存储:对象存储采用分布式架构,提高系统可用性和可靠性。

(4)弹性扩展:对象存储系统可根据需求动态扩展存储空间。

(5)安全性:对象存储系统支持多种安全机制,保障数据安全。

对象存储集群的概念

1、定义

对象存储集群(Object Storage Cluster)是指在同一个物理区域或多个物理区域中,通过高速网络连接多个对象存储节点,形成一个协同工作的存储系统,对象存储集群具备更高的性能、可用性和可靠性。

2、特点

(1)高性能:对象存储集群通过高速网络连接多个节点,实现数据读写的高效传输。

(2)高可用性:集群中节点可相互备份,保证系统在高并发场景下稳定运行。

对象存储的概念,深入剖析,对象存储与对象存储集群的区别及层级解析

(3)弹性扩展:集群可根据需求动态添加或删除节点,实现存储空间的弹性扩展。

(4)数据冗余:集群中数据采用多副本存储,提高数据可靠性。

对象存储与对象存储集群的区别

1、架构层级

(1)对象存储:对象存储是一种存储技术,主要关注数据存储和访问。

(2)对象存储集群:对象存储集群是一种基于对象存储技术的扩展方案,旨在提高系统性能、可用性和可靠性。

2、性能

(1)对象存储:对象存储性能受限于单个节点,适用于小规模、低并发的数据存储场景。

(2)对象存储集群:对象存储集群通过多个节点协同工作,实现高性能数据存储和访问。

3、可用性

对象存储的概念,深入剖析,对象存储与对象存储集群的区别及层级解析

(1)对象存储:对象存储可用性受限于单个节点,存在单点故障风险。

(2)对象存储集群:对象存储集群通过节点冗余和备份机制,提高系统可用性。

4、扩展性

(1)对象存储:对象存储扩展性受限于单个节点存储空间,难以满足大规模数据存储需求。

(2)对象存储集群:对象存储集群可通过动态添加节点实现存储空间的弹性扩展。

对象存储与对象存储集群在架构、性能、可用性和扩展性等方面存在显著差异,对象存储是一种存储技术,而对象存储集群是一种基于对象存储技术的扩展方案,在实际应用中,根据业务需求和场景选择合适的存储方案至关重要,通过深入了解两者之间的区别,有助于更好地发挥对象存储和对象存储集群的优势,为业务发展提供有力支持。

黑狐家游戏

发表评论

最新文章